Bits 0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31 – DATAx Flash Write Data

The value in this register(s) is written to flash when a Write operation is commanded.

Single Write: (64-bit data)

Writes DATA0 to ADDR[31:3] with address bits [2:0] = 000

Writes DATA1 to ADDR[31:3] with address bits [2:0] = 100

Quad Write: (256-bit data)

Writes DATA0 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 0_0000

Writes DATA1 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 0_0100

Writes DATA2 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 0_1000

Writes DATA3 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 0_1100

Writes DATA4 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 1_0000

Writes DATA5 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 1_0100

Writes DATA6 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 1_1000

Writes DATA7 to ADDR[31:5], with address bits[4:0] = 1_1100

Note: This field can only be modified when STATUS.BUSY=0.
